Hattar: Senate Chairman Syed Yousaf Raza Gillani inaugurated the Murree Sparklets RO Plant and Water Line Unit 2 in Hattar, emphasizing the importance of access to clean and safe drinking water for all citizens.
In his address, Chairman Gillani congratulated the management of Murree Sparklets and all those involved in completing the project, highlighting that it marks a significant milestone in providing a fundamental necessity to the public. He stressed that the availability of clean drinking water is not only a development goal but also a basic right of every citizen.
Chairman Gillani emphasized that access to clean drinking water is essential for public health and well-being.
He praised the private sector for playing a vital role in the country's development, creating jobs and contributing to the economy.
The Senate Chairman assured full support for initiatives that prioritize public welfare and development.
He appreciated the use of modern technology in the plant and the adoption of environmentally friendly practices.
Chairman Gillani also visited the ACM Group of Industries, where he was briefed about the group's operations. He praised the institution's head, Senator Muhammad Talha Mahmood, and the administration for their efforts. During the visit, he planted a tree in the factory's lawn and appreciated the use of modern technology and environmentally friendly practices in the plant.
The Senate Chairman emphasized the importance of the industrial sector in the country's economy and assured full support for its growth and development.
